Picture this: you're out on a crisp morning, targeting bass in a weed-choked bayou or navigating stump-filled shallows on your favorite small boat. The last thing you need is a trolling motor that quits or steers like a shopping cart with a wobbly wheel. That's where the Minn Kota Edge 45 shines. This compact powerhouse combines rugged simplicity with precise control, making it a go-to choice for freshwater enthusiasts who demand reliability without the bells and whistles of high-end models.
Built for boats under 16 feet, its 36-inch shaft and 45-pound thrust deliver just enough push to handle tough conditions while sipping battery life efficiently. Anglers love how the cable-steer foot pedal lets them keep eyes on the water, freeing hands for rods and reels. It's not flashy, but it's the kind of motor that gets you back to the dock with a limit of fish and zero drama.
The Edge 45's mount is no afterthought—it's extruded anodized aluminum, tough enough to shrug off dock bumps and trailering mishaps. Pair that with the innovative Latch & Door bracket, and stowing or removing the motor becomes a one-handed job. No fumbling with straps or levers when you're racing a thunderstorm or securing gear overnight.
The heel-toe foot pedal is where this motor earns its keep. Responsive and ergonomic, it offers 5 forward speeds and 3 reverse for dialing in exact trolling speeds—perfect for finesse presentations like drop-shotting or dragging worms. The built-in directional indicator on the head gives instant feedback, so you're never guessing your heading amid waves or fog.
Power through thick milfoil or hydrilla with the included Power Prop (MKP-2). Its design grabs more water, providing that extra grunt when wind fights your position holds.
In my experience guiding on Midwest reservoirs, the Edge 45 has powered countless jon boats through current breaks and wind drifts. It's ideal for kayak anglers too, with the bow mount keeping weight forward for stability. Pair it with a Group 24 battery, and you'll fish all day on one charge. Users report it outperforms bulkier competitors in tight spots, where maneuverability trumps raw power.
For tournament bass chasers or family walleye trips, the 42-amp draw at full tilt means efficient power management—crucial when running livewells and electronics.
Mounting is straightforward: bolt the bracket to your bow deck, connect to a 12-volt deep-cycle battery, and you're trolling in under an hour. Position the shaft to clear the waterline by 12-18 inches for optimal bite. Regular rinse-downs after salty spray (even in freshwater zones near estuaries) prevent buildup, and annual prop checks ensure peak performance.
Pro tip: Tilt the motor fully up for trailering to protect the lower unit. With a 2-year warranty, Minn Kota's support team has your back for any tweaks.

Edge lets you step right up to treacherous stump fields, tangled weed beds, or punishing wind and waves. Big challenges like those usually mean bigger fish. And when you've got the unrelenting, rugged construction of Edge - available in foot or hand control models - you've got the power to rise to the occasion.
The updated motor mounts on the Edge motors feature an extruded upper arm made from marine-grade anodized aluminum that is built for years of trouble-free use.
The Edge cable-steer motors feature a redesigned motor head that is constructed of highly impact-resistant, hybrid composite material for unmatched durability. The head also integrates a high-visibility directional indicator. And the ultra-responsive foot pedal is ergonomically designed for precise speed and steering control.
Edge motors also utilize a Latch & Door mounting system for easy removal of the motor for security and storage. Adding to its ruggedness, The Edge has a composite shaft that is guaranteed for life
